Friday, 18 November 2011 By Sharon Hall THE naming ceremony of Celebrity Silhouette in Hamburg was very much synonymous with cruising itself - all inclusive, luxurious, if even a little over the top. The American owners of this mammoth ship ensured this was a thoroughly European affair - entirely fitting as it’s the burgeoning German market that the canny accountants have their eye on. The German national anthem got a warm welcome which was only fitting as the ship was built by Meyer Werft at their shipyard in Papenburge. But there was also a salute to Celebrity’s Greek heritage, when the Greek national anthem was sung by Capt. Dimitrios Kafetzis and 15 of his fellow Greek officers. Even people from Europe’s outpost got a nod at this up-market knees up, as the festivities began with a procession by the Royal Air Force Halton Pipes & Drums playing the Glens of Antrim. The 122,000-ton, 2,886-passenger Celebrity Silhouette is the fourth ship in Celebrity Cruises' innovative Solstice class, which includes Celebrity Solstice, Celebrity Equinox and Celebrity Eclipse and debuts with a series of Holy Land sailings out of Rome. For those who know their cruise ships, be assured this is really the last word in luxury - in fact - a whole new word has been coined by those in charge.
